Where is Spiegelgracht?
Where is Spiegelgracht located?
Spiegelgracht, Spiegelgracht, Netherlands (approx. 52.3619°, 4.88722°)
Where is Spiegelgracht on the map?
{"latitude":52.3619,"longitude":4.88722,"title":"Spiegelgracht"}